Common Scaly Albino Carp
The albino form of a scaly carp is characterized, primarily, by the absence of pigmentation in its scales and skin. It is generally accepted that albinos are not as hardy as common species. In addition, their eyes are more sensitive to sunlight, so they often prefer to live in dark shady places. Otherwise, these fish do not differ from common scaly carp.
